A Cochrane database review included 15 clinical trials of 1,219 total participants. Chitosan supplementation slightly improved weight loss (‐1.7 kg on average). However, this review failed to confirm increased fat excretion.

WebJun 1, 2024 · Chitosan is a non-toxic, biodegradable and biocompatible amino polysaccharide which makes it useful for the encapsulation of various active ingredients with potential applications. Chitosan coating on food products, for example, gives them protection from possible antimicrobial attacks, antioxidants and extended shelf life.
